#4b0ce9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b0ce9 is composed of 29.4% red, 4.7%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 94.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 257.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 48%. #4b0ce9 color hex could be obtained by blending #9618ff with #0000d3.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

Shades and Tints of #4b0ce9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030009 is the darkest color, while #f8f5ff is the lightest one.
